The Real Cost of Substandard Industrial Concrete
Many Fort Wayne business owners underestimate how poor-quality concrete affects their bottom line. Beyond the obvious repair and replacement costs, inferior concrete creates a cascade of operational challenges that impact productivity and profitability.
Concrete that wasn’t properly designed for industrial loads develops cracks, spalling, and uneven surfaces that damage equipment and create safety hazards. Forklifts operating on deteriorated concrete experience increased wear and tear, leading to higher maintenance costs and more frequent replacements. Production equipment suffers from vibration and instability when concrete foundations aren’t engineered to proper specifications.
The hidden costs extend to employee safety and insurance liability. Uneven or damaged concrete surfaces increase the risk of workplace accidents, potentially leading to workers’ compensation claims and OSHA violations. Poor drainage in concrete areas can create slip hazards and contribute to mold and mildew problems that affect indoor air quality.
Businesses also face unexpected downtime when concrete failures require emergency repairs. A cracked loading dock or damaged warehouse floor can shut down operations until proper repairs are completed, resulting in lost revenue and customer dissatisfaction.

Specialized Industrial Concrete Applications
Fort Wayne’s diverse industrial landscape requires concrete solutions tailored to specific operational needs. Manufacturing facilities often need concrete that can withstand chemical exposure, heavy point loads, and constant vibration from production equipment.
Distribution centers and warehouses require ultra-flat concrete floors that allow for efficient forklift operation and high-density storage systems. These applications demand precise elevation control and specialized finishing techniques that most general contractors lack the expertise to deliver properly.
Food processing facilities need concrete that meets strict sanitation requirements, including seamless surfaces that can withstand frequent washdowns and chemical sanitizers. The concrete must also provide proper drainage and resist bacterial growth.
Automotive and heavy manufacturing facilities require concrete capable of supporting overhead cranes, heavy machinery, and concentrated loads. This typically involves specialized foundation designs and high-strength concrete mixes engineered for specific applications.
Cold storage facilities present unique challenges, requiring concrete designed to perform in extreme temperature variations and prevent frost heaving that can damage floors and foundations.
The Engineering Behind Durable Industrial Concrete
Professional industrial concrete Fort Wayne, IN projects begin with comprehensive engineering analysis that considers your facility’s specific requirements. This includes analyzing equipment loads, traffic patterns, environmental conditions, and operational demands to develop concrete specifications that ensure long-term performance.
Mix design represents a critical component of industrial concrete success. Different applications require specific concrete strengths, aggregate types, and additive packages. High-traffic areas might need fiber-reinforced concrete for crack resistance, while chemical processing areas require concrete with specific chemical resistance properties.
Proper joint design and placement prevent cracking and ensure long-term durability. Industrial facilities experience significant temperature variations and structural movement that must be accommodated through strategic joint placement and appropriate sealant systems.
Curing procedures for industrial concrete differ significantly from residential applications. Professional contractors use specialized curing compounds, controlled environment techniques, and extended curing periods to achieve optimal strength and durability.
Quality control throughout the construction process includes concrete testing, thickness verification, and surface tolerance measurements to ensure the finished product meets engineering specifications and performance requirements.

Selecting the Right Industrial Concrete Contractor in Fort Wayne
Not all concrete contractors in Fort Wayne have the expertise, equipment, and experience necessary for industrial applications. Start by researching contractors with documented experience in industrial projects similar to your requirements.
Verify that potential contractors carry appropriate licensing, insurance, and bonding for commercial industrial work. Industrial concrete projects involve significantly higher liability exposures than residential work, requiring comprehensive coverage.
Request detailed portfolios showing completed industrial projects, including project specifications, performance requirements, and long-term performance data when available. Reputable contractors should be able to provide references from similar industrial clients.
Evaluate the contractor’s equipment capabilities. Industrial concrete projects often require specialized pumping equipment, finishing tools, and testing instruments that general concrete contractors may not possess.
Ask about quality control procedures, testing protocols, and warranty provisions. Professional industrial concrete contractors should provide comprehensive warranties and detailed quality assurance documentation.
